Output b63256e19123f0624e57efc9bdbc437d03a621305f088c32e7e066fbc3fda85d:2

value
3984495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856e2656cdb7dd22ae98308cd4cccd38822b666c OP_EQUAL
address
3DrXkPyDFbEm5UjqgbYHSDYoYnKQxGjaeC
transaction
b63256e19123f0624e57efc9bdbc437d03a621305f088c32e7e066fbc3fda85d
confirmations
34600
spent
true